BIR announces Alexandre Delacoux as its new director-general

Wednesday, 04 September 2013 16:36:00 (GMT+3)   |   Istanbul
       

The Bureau of International Recycling (BIR) has named Alexandre Delacoux as its new director-general as of September 1, replacing Francis Veys who is retiring from BIR. Delacoux joined BIR as general manager at the end of 2012.
 
BIR president Björn Grufman paid tribute to Francis Veys for his immense achievements and for leading BIR so successfully for almost four decades.
